Software Engineer (f/m/d) PHP
TeamShirts was launched in 2014 as a new brand from Spread Group, offering tools and products specifically tailored to groups and teams for customization and shopping. Over time, a small crew with strong start-up vibes has grown into a sizable team that now manages 13 domains in 8 different languages, equipping teams all over Europe and North America.
Does a mixture of an established corporate organization and agile start-up atmosphere sound exciting? Then TeamShirts is the right place for you!
Our Tech Stack
- We use PHP 8 and Symfony 5 to work on existing backend services and WebApps
- We mainly use GraphQL and have replaced almost all of our REST endpoints
- For data storage, we use different systems like MySQL and Elasticsearch, but also Redis
- In the frontend, we use TypeScript and React with Redux, e.g. for our T-Shirt Designer
- We use Docker and Kubernetes for deployments
- You will actively participate in the technology planning – we are open to new or more suitable tools and pertinent approaches
You’re one of us – if…
- You feel at home in the backend, or if are interested in full-stack development
- You are experienced in working with databases and APIs
- You have gathered some work experience or a degree in IT or a comparable field of study
- You value stable and future-oriented solutions, but at the same time you are pragmatic about agile, test-driven, and incremental development in a start-up environment
- You like to work in a self-organized team with a clear focus on quality
- You have no problem speaking and writing in English to communicate in-house
We value diversity at Spread Group. We are proud of and continue to encourage the increasing diversity of our company culture and community. Your skills, talents, and experience are our focus no matter your age, ethnicity, religion, national origin, gender, sexual orientation, marital or disability status.
We offer you
- A team that communicates in short ways and deals with each other in a relaxed, cooperative manner on eye level
- Working with a scalable (microservice) architecture in the e-commerce environment
- Flexible working hours – we trust you to do your job with an option to work remotely
- Software development in an agile, modern environment with cross-functional and self-organized teams of developers, product owners, and designers
- No fixed release dates, but continuous delivery
- Inhouse software development – we are our own “customer”
- Through code reviews, we share our knowledge, establish best practices, and continue to develop our skills
- The opportunity to attend conferences, try out new things in our Hacking Days and to develop yourself further in your job according to your interests
- Maximum freedom regarding the choice of your development environment; Mac or Linux, the choice is yours
- A pleasant environment with sun terraces, fruit for health, table tennis tournaments, and other events – and of course lots of T-shirts
- Meet-a-Spreadster and learn more about the first days as a Software Engineer at Spread Group
- You can find more insights into the Spread Group’s everyday life on kununu and Instagram
We look forward to receiving your application, preferably online via our career portal in German or English or as a PDF document to jobs@spreadgroup.com. Please state reference number V00-1420 and don't forget to let us know about salary expectations and your earliest starting date.
P.S.: We love creative CVs, a can-do attitude, and fresh perspectives. We want characters full of ideas and drive – no matter how old you are, where you come from or what your background is. Show us what you're made of!
We would like to fill this position without support of staffing agencies.

WHAT WE OFFER

Diversity

Feel-Good Benefits

Modern Work Life

Transparency

Respect
